Transaction 38c43e4e504c555188e957924d5276848c4a7d7bb5228de19f7729478816e5be
1 Input
2 Outputs
- 38c43e4e504c555188e957924d5276848c4a7d7bb5228de19f7729478816e5be:0
- 38c43e4e504c555188e957924d5276848c4a7d7bb5228de19f7729478816e5be:1
value 4157059
address 3C77SHDnawBKDnoFpTHJoRUCnBGFX9kpcL
value 124344255
address 13TYg8A4GxZhNr1QhKKGftyJBMQVADhJ5L